Erin is an associate attorney practicing primarily in the area of Civil Litigation. She first joined DBL Law as a summer associate in 2018.
Erin received her Juris Doctor from the Brandeis School of Law at the University of Louisville where she graduated magna cum laude in 2019. During law school, Erin served as Senior Articles Editor for the University of Louisville Law Review and was a member of the Robert F. Wagner Labor and Employment Law Moot Court Team. She also participated in externships with Judge Rebecca Grady Jennings in the U.S. District Court for the Western District of Kentucky, and at Signature HealthCARE, and in the Kentucky Attorney General’s Office.
Prior to attending law school, Erin graduated summa cum laude with a Bachelor’s Degree in Political Science from Murray State University. While at Murray State, Erin served in various leadership positions with the Student Government Association, including serving as Chief Justice of the Judicial Board.
Erin is a native of, and currently resides in Louisville, KY.
